The Pressurized Cavity for Breathing Underwater (PCBU) is a cabin equipped with a bottom opening, enabling divers without diving gear to access compressed air or surface-supplied equipment. Serving as an underwater air-filled cavity (moon pool), it allows divers to breathe and continue their work submerged. Additionally, the PCBU can be utilized for tasks such as coral planting on coral tables or reef balls. Operable at depths up to 8 meters to prevent decompression sickness, the PCBU features a compressor and umbilical cord extending to the surface via balloons. The compressor generates compressed air to fill the cavity upon deployment, with the same device filling an onboard air tank for diver control. Intended for localized use, the PCBU is transported by boat; when nearing the work site, a built-in propeller propels it into place before being secured to the seafloor via yellow hatches.
